This coming Tuesday, August 29, is a big day for Colts RB Jonathan Taylor. ESPN's Stephen Holder reports that the team has given Taylor until Tuesday to find a trade partner. Two teams have already submitted offers to the Colts, per Holder, although it's unclear if either is close to what the Colts are looking for. Tuesday is also when teams must decide what to do with players on the active/PUP list, as Taylor is. Taylor will either need to be activated to the 53-man roster, or move to reserve/PUP, which would cost him the first four weeks of the season. We'll have a much better idea of Taylor's 2023 fantasy outlook by the end of Tuesday. Stay tuned.
